We are hiring for Network Engineer (Automation) in Ottawa Office Canada (Hybrid: 2–3 days/week onsite or as needed) Overview: Join IP/Optical Networks team to drive development of automation tools that support professional services for major telecom clients. This role blends advanced telecom knowledge with hands-on software development in a fast-paced, collaborative environment. Key Responsibilities: Work across the full development lifecycle—design, develop, test, and deploy automation tools. Collaborate closely with architects and senior engineers to ensure high-quality deliverables. Troubleshoot and resolve complex system and code-level issues. Design and implement robust, scalable software features and tools. Continuously optimize system performance and architecture. Contribute to documentation, code reviews, and solution design sessions. Support root cause analysis and help scale existing infrastructure. Required Qualifications: Telecom Experience: Minimum 5 years in the telecom/IP/MPLS space, preferably with a Service Provider supporting mobile and enterprise services. Technical Skills: Strong coding skills in at least one high-level language (Python preferred; Java, C#, or Jinja also acceptable). Solid understanding of IP/MPLS technologies (IPv4/IPv6, L2VPN, L3VPN, VLL, QoS, Multicast, BNG, CGNAT, redundancy). Hands-on experience with scripting (JavaScript, HTML5) and PHP-based front ends. Proficient in Linux environments and virtualization concepts. Automation & DevOps: Experience with orchestration tools (StackStorm, Ansible preferred). Familiarity with Jenkins or other CI/CD tools. Containerization knowledge (Docker preferred) and automation of server deployment/config. Database & Systems: Experience with non-relational databases (MongoDB preferred). Comfortable working with source control systems (Git preferred). Familiar with OpenStack, Mistral workflows, and SDN technologies. Soft Skills: High attention to detail and quality coding practices. Excellent problem-solving and debugging skills.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a hybrid team setting.
